what law does static electricity illustrate

OpenStudy (anonymous):

static electricity is produce by frictional force applied between to particular kind of objects having certain properties like. like some object may have excess of electron on its surface and it may loose some just by rubbing it. example: take a ball pen of plastic body and rub it on your dry hair and take near to very small pieces of papers it will attract these pieces. but this electricity is temporary the electrons lost by rubbing are restored by the environment by the time.
